I have kubuntu 10.04 installed and choosed the PT-PT language for the system language, but the language that is used is not PT-PT but PT-BR. I see this in multiple wait windows messages and system messages like in Kpackagekit when updating packages list it uses PT-BR message.

Hi Helder,
Thanks for reporting this bug. Could you please:
1. Open a terminal
2. Type the following command, followed by Return: locale
3. Copy and paste the output as a comment in this bug
It might also be that it is not a bug, but simply translation fallback in action: as far as I know, Brazilian Portuguese is a fallback for Portuguese, so that if a message is not translated in Portuguese but it is translated in Brazilian, it will be shown in Brazilian, which will be more understandable by users than English.
Did you see this happening in many applications? Are other messages in Portuguese?
